Guyana adds 22 skilled technicians to support renewable energy transition

Twenty-two individuals have joined Guyana’s pool of skilled renewable energy technicians after completing specialised training in Electric Vehicle Systems and Solar PV Charging Infrastructure. The initiative was implemented through a partnership among the Board of Industrial Training (BIT), the Guyana Energy Agency (GEA), the International Organisation for Migration (IOM), and the United Nations.
